The Womb Cave
The Womb is an ancient sanctuary dating back to the 11th–10th century BC. At the end of the cave, there is a carved altar just over one meter high, and at the top of the cave, there is a crack through which a sunbeam enters for a few minutes every day at 12 noon.

Chilyaka peak
The path to it takes about 4 hours and passes through an exceptionally beautiful landscape. The area is dotted with megaliths from the Thracian period, and the views of the Arda River and the Kardzhali reservoir are unforgettable.

Medieval Fortress Patmos
The name Patmos translates from Thracian as “Rock among rivers.” Remains of fortress walls, foundations of a tower, and a church have been preserved. Patmos is a fortress with an irregular rectangular shape, with many of the fortress walls and towers still preserved today, reaching over 3 meters high in some places.
